Psalm 107:40

he pours contempt on princes and makes them wander in trackless wastes;

Job 12:24

He takes away understanding from the chiefs of the people of the earth and makes them wander in a trackless waste.

Job 12:21

He pours contempt on princes and loosens the belt of the strong.
